func translateServiceConfig(config *framework.ServiceConfig, instances int) *marathon.Application {
	application := marathon.NewDockerApplication()
	imageWithTag := config.ImageName + ":" + config.Tag
	labels := map[string]string{
		"image_name": config.ImageName,
		"image_tag":  config.Tag,
	}

	application.Name(config.ServiceID)

	if config.Constraints["slave_name"] != "" {
		labels["slave_name"] = config.Constraints["slave_name"]
	}

	// default value for CPU
	if config.CPUShares != 0.0 {
		application.CPU(config.CPUShares)
	} else {
		application.CPU(0.25)
	}

	if config.DockerCfg != "" {
		//uris := make([]string, 1)
		//uris = append(uris, config.DockerCfg)
		//application.Uris = []string{config.DockerCfg}
		application.Uris = append(application.Uris, config.DockerCfg)
	}
	application.Memory(float64(config.Memory))
	application.Count(instances)
	application.Env = utils.StringSlice2Map(config.Envs)
	application.Env["SERVICE_NAME"] = config.ServiceID
	application.Labels = labels

	//upgradeStrategy
	application.UpgradeStrategy = &marathon.UpgradeStrategy{
		MinimumHealthCapacity: config.MinimumHealthCapacity,
		MaximumOverCapacity:   config.MaximumOverCapacity,
	}

	//application.RequirePorts = true
	populateConstraints(application, config)
	// add the docker container
	application.Container.Docker.Container(imageWithTag)
	application.Container.Docker.PortMappings = createPorMappings(config.Publish)
	application.Container.Docker.Parameters = populateParameters(config)
	// Http Health Check
	addHealthCheck(application, config)
	return application
}

func translateServiceConfig(config framework.ServiceConfig, instances int) (*marathon.Application, error) {
	application := marathon.NewDockerApplication()
	imageWithTag := config.ImageName + ":" + config.Tag

	application.Name(config.ServiceID)

	// default value for CPU
	application.CPU(0.25)
	if config.CPUShares != 0.0 {
		application.CPU(config.CPUShares)
	}

	if config.DockerCfg != "" {
		application.Uris = append(application.Uris, config.DockerCfg)
	}
	application.Memory(float64(config.Memory))
	application.Count(instances)
	application.Env = utils.StringSlice2Map(config.Envs)

	//upgradeStrategy
	application.UpgradeStrategy = &marathon.UpgradeStrategy{
		MinimumHealthCapacity: config.MinimumHealthCapacity,
		MaximumOverCapacity:   config.MaximumOverCapacity,
	}

	populateLabels(application, config)

	//application.RequirePorts = true
	if err := populateConstraints(application, config); err != nil {
		return nil, err
	}

	// add the docker container
	application.Container.Docker.Container(imageWithTag)
	application.Container.Docker.PortMappings = createPorMappings(config.Publish)
	application.Container.Docker.Parameters = populateParameters(config)
	// Http Health Check
	if err := addHealthCheck(application, config); err != nil {
		return nil, err
	}

	return application, nil
}
